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) is a AHA certification class for healthcare providers to enhance their skills in the treatment of the adult victim of a cardiac arrest or other cardiopulmonary emergencies. ACLS - Initial Course. ACLS - Renewal Course.ACLS Course Objectives AHA ACLS book pg. 1. Apply the BLS, Primary and Secondary Assessment sequences for a systematic evaluation of adult patients. Perform prompt, high quality BLS, including prioritizing early chest compressions and integrating early AED use. The American Heart Association (AHA) formally endorsed c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) in 1963, and by 1966 they had adopted standardized CPR guidelines for instruction to lay rescuers [ 2 ]. The Precourse Self-Assessment helps evaluate knowledge necessary to be successful in the ACLS Provider Course and determines the need for additional review and practice. A minimum score of 70% must be achieved to pass the Precourse Self-Assessment. Learn about AHA course offerings targeted towards healthcare professionals -including basic and advanced life support courses.High-quality CPR is the primary component in influencing survival from cardiac arrest. To save more lives, healthcare providers must be competent in delivering high-quality CPR, and patient care teams must be coordinated and competent working together effectively.
